Community Colleges in Washington State


Bring your skis or snowboard to the slopes of the Cascade Range, known as the "Switzerland of North America." Explore the San Juan Islands, Mt. St. Helen’s National Volcanic Monument, which last erupted in 1980, or the Rocky Mountains. If wildlife interests you, keep an eye out for bald eagles, Roosevelt elk and gray whales or watch salmon travel the Columbia River on their annual migration. Whatever your passion, the Evergreen State, which is named after George Washington, is sure to be full of pleasant surprises.

Green River Community College
Green River Community College is located in Auburn,Washington, a city of 35,000 people. Auburn's location provides access to a wide variety of outdoor activities including hiking, skiing, boating, and other water sports. The Auburn area is also graced with 26 parks, three 18-hole golf courses, and a system of trails for jogging, horseback riding, bicycling and roller blading. Students live in a beautiful location, 35 minutes from Seattle and 25 minutes from the Seattle-Tacoma International Airport.

Key facts
-Location: Auburn, Washington
-Founded: 1963
-Enrollment: 9,000 students
-Campus setting: Beautiful edge of town property - surrounded by North Pacific mountains,water and forest
-Housing: Student residence
-Nearest airport: Seattle-Tacoma, SEATAC
-TOEFL: Accepts TOEFL, IELTS
No minimum TOEFL for ESL
500/173 minimum TOEFL for academic programs

Seattle Central Community College
Seattle is one of the most beautiful, ethnically diverse and vibrant cities in America. SCCC was established to provide quality global education experiences to local and international students and faculty. Seattle Central fosters learning communities that bring American and international students together for meaningful interaction. Career and Professional counseling is available to help students identify their personal and professional areas for further development. Year 12 students are welcome with or without a high school diploma. Year 11 students can complete their Year 12 high school and first year of community college simultaneously, right on campus!

Key facts
-Location: Seattle , Washington
-Founded: 1989 - International Program
-Enrollment: 10,000 students (700+ international)
-Campus setting: Medium city, five minutes from city centre
-Housing: Host family
-Nearest airport: SEATAC, Seattle-Tacoma
-TOEFL: No minimum TOEFL required
English testing upon arrival
ESL available on campus
